  • Korean Patent Publication No. 10-2002-0059949 (hereinafter referred to as "the first document") uses a fingerprint reader mounted on a CD and an ATM to process financial transactions using fingerprints having a unique form for each individual. After verifying the identity of a trader, a financial transaction method using a fingerprint for requesting a fingerprint transaction approval from a financial institution is disclosed. To this end, in the first document, financial institutions compare the fingerprint data acquired from the trader's fingerprint and the resident registration card in response to the fingerprint transaction request from the trader, and permit financial transactions according to the result. This should be confirmed in real time.
  • 10-2004-0021747 (hereinafter referred to as "2nd document") captures a user's face and transmits it to a network server for identity verification, and scans a user's fingerprint and user's identification card to a network server.
  • a loan-only card issuing apparatus is disclosed which allows a network server to verify a user's identity by transmitting.
  • Korean Utility Model Registration Publication No. 181614 discloses a cash withdrawal device for storing a fingerprint in a storage means and withdrawing cash by determining the coincidence with the fingerprint stored in the card.
  • the first, second and third documents mentioned above allow financial transactions with reference to whether the user's fingerprint matches the fingerprint of the identification card. However, if the ID card is forged, there is a significant risk in determining whether or not the financial transaction is granted based on the coincidence of the fingerprints.

  • the present invention for achieving the above object is carried out through the unmanned loan processing device connected to the financial institution server, credit information agency server, and unmanned loan agency server, (a) identification of customer forgery and identification of the customer Authenticating; (b) receiving a loan request amount of the customer on the premise of forgery of identification card and completion of authentication of the identification of the customer; (c) requesting the credit rating of the customer from the credit bureau server using the customer information verified through the loan request amount and ID card of the customer and receiving the response; (d) querying a database provided from each of the affiliated financial institution servers based on the credit rating and the desired loan amount of the customer, and selecting and presenting to the customer a financial institution which is available for loaning; (e) if one of the presented financial institutions is selected by the customer, requesting the selected financial institution to apply for a loan execution input by the customer; And (f) receiving loan approval information from a financial institution that has requested a loan execution application and informing a customer of the result of the loan approval.
  • step (a) comprises the steps of (a-1) receiving an ID of a customer; (a-2) detecting image information by image-taking the input ID card, and comparing the infrared transmission value obtained by irradiating the ID card with infrared rays and determining the forgery of the ID card by comparing the standard infrared transmission value provided in the database; (a-3) discontinuing the proceedings of the unmanned loan upon forgery of the identification card as a result of the determination; (a-4) determining the identification of the customer by capturing the fingerprint of the customer when the identification of the identification card is normal and acquiring the fingerprint information, and comparing it with the image information of the fingerprint obtained from the identification card of the customer; And (a-5) if the fingerprint is inconsistent as a result of the identification of the customer, stopping the procedure of proceeding with the unmanned loan, and if the fingerprint is matched, completing the customer authentication for the next proceeding of the unmanned loan. .
  • the step (a) comprises the steps of (a-11) receiving the identification card of the customer and detecting the image information through image capturing of the identification card; (a-12) photographing the fingerprint of the customer to obtain fingerprint information; (a-13) determining the identity by comparing the fingerprint of the image information detected through the image capturing of the identification card with the fingerprint information of the fingerprint of the customer; (a-14) discontinuing the proceedings of the unmanned loan in case of inconsistency as a result of the determination of identity; (a-15) determining the identity by comparing the fingerprint or the fingerprint information of the image information with the fingerprint information registered by the customer in the government agency if the match is found; And (a-16) If the customer is inconsistent with the fingerprint information registered with the government agency, the ID card forgery is judged to be suspended, and the procedure of unmanned loan is stopped. Comprising a step of completing the customer authentication to process normal.

  • the financial institution server 10, the credit information agency server 20, and the unmanned loan processing device 100 connected to the unmanned loan agency server 30 and the network 40 is forgery of the identification card of the customer and identification of the customer Authenticate (S110).
  • the forgery of the identification card of the customer and the authentication step (S110) of the identification of the customer may be processed by a process as shown in FIG. 5.
  • the unmanned loan processing apparatus 100 receives an ID of a customer through an ID card insertion hole 102 (S111), detects image information by imaging an ID card input through the ID card insertion hole 102, and enters an ID card. By comparing the infrared transmission value obtained by irradiating the infrared ray and the standard infrared transmission value provided in the database (not shown) it is determined whether the ID card forgery (S112).
  • the process of proceeding with the unmanned loan is stopped (S113), when the identification of the identification card of the customer through the fingerprint imaging unit 106 to fingerprint the fingerprint Obtaining the information, and checks the identity of the customer by comparing it with the image information of the fingerprint obtained from the identification card of the customer (S114).
  • Figure 6 is an operation flow chart of another example showing the authentication step of forgery and identification of the identification card of the unmanned loan processing method according to the present invention.
  • the unmanned loan processing apparatus 100 receives an ID of a customer through an ID insertion slot 102 and detects image information through image capturing of the ID (S121).
  • the unmanned loan processing apparatus 100 obtains fingerprint information by imaging the fingerprint of the customer through the fingerprint imaging unit 106 (S122).
  • the unmanned loan processing apparatus 100 determines the sameness through the comparison of the fingerprint of the image information detected through the image capturing of the identification card in step S121 and the fingerprint information of the fingerprint of the customer in step S122. (S123).
  • the unmanned loan processing apparatus 100 determines that the ID card is forgery when it is inconsistent with the fingerprint information registered by the government agency and stops the procedure of unmanned loan (S126), and the customer matches the fingerprint information registered by the government agency.
  • the city completes customer authentication for handling ID card forgery and customer confirmation as normal (S127).
  • the authentication step (S110) shown in Figure 5 is a method for determining whether the forgery of the identification card, by determining the forgery through the analysis of the unique infrared transmission value of the identification card, it is strictly security management in government agencies On the premise, the forgery is judged, and the authentication of the forgery and identification of the customer is completed by comparing the fingerprint of the image information captured on the ID card with the fingerprint information input by the customer who is in the process of unmanned loan.
  • the authentication step (S110) shown in FIG. 6 determines the identity of the fingerprint of the image information captured by the customer's identification card and the fingerprint information captured by the customer's fingerprint, and then re-registers the fingerprint information registered with the government agency. This is done by comparing the process of determining identity.
  • the identification of the forgery of the ID card is compared with the fingerprint of the image information detected from the identification card of the customer, the fingerprint information of the customer, and the fingerprint information registered in the government agency. The verification of the customer's identification is completed.
  • the fingerprint information registered with the government agency is usually used when creating the first identification card, even if the original identification card for the crime is forged and used, it is possible to check the forgery in the identification of the customer, thereby causing a financial accident due to the forgery. Can be prevented in advance.

Abstract

La présente invention se rapporte à un procédé de traitement destiné à un prêt automatique. Selon ce procédé de traitement de prêt automatique : un dispositif de traitement de prêt automatique qui est connecté à un serveur d'institutions financières, à un serveur d'institutions fournissant des renseignements sur la solvabilité et à un serveur d'institutions de prêts automatiques est utilisé; la contrefaçon ou la falsification d'un ID de client sont vérifiées, et il est confirmé que le client est l'utilisateur grâce à une vérification d'empreintes digitales ou autre; des institutions financières pouvant accorder un prêt sont sélectionnées parmi les institutions financières associées, sur la base des renseignements sur la solvabilité qui sont demandés et du montant du prêt souhaité, et en même temps, l'argent pouvant être prêté ainsi qu'un taux d'intérêt sont donnés; et le client reçoit une approbation de prêt en provenance d'une ou plusieurs des institutions financières sélectionnées.
